Lamentations 5:20 - Long
Verse | Strongs No. | Hebrew | |
---|---|---|---|
Wherefore | H4100 | מָה |
properly interrogitive what ? (including {how ?} why ? and when ?); but also exclamations like what ! (including {how !}) or indefinitely what (including {whatever} and even relatively that which); often used with prefixes in various adverbial or conjugational sneses |
dost thou forget | H7911 | שָׁכַח |
[Verb] to {mislay} that {is} to be oblivious {of} from want of memory or attention |
us for ever and forsake | H5800 | עָזַב |
[Verb] to {loosen} that {is} relinquish: {permit} etc. |
us so long | H753 | אֹרֶךְ |
[Noun Masculine] length |
time | H3117 | יוֹם |
[Noun Masculine] a day (as the warm {hours}) whether literally (from sunrise to {sunset} or from one sunset to the {next}) or figuratively (a space of time defined by an associated {term}) (often used adverbially) |
Definitions are taken from Strong's Exhaustive Concordance
by James Strong (S.T.D.) (LL.D.) 1890.
